Porous TiO2 nanobelts with rutile/anatase phase junctions are successfully prepared through a hydrothermal route and ion exchange process. X-ray diffraction (XRD), scanning electron microscopy (SEM) and transmission electron microscopy (TEM) were conducted to characterize the products. The photocatalytic performance of the porous nanobelts was evaluated by measuring the degradation of methyl blue under UV light irradiation. The photocatalytic activity of the porous nanobelts is much superior to that of P-25 and pristine non-porous nanobelts. The excellent photocatalytic of porous nanobelts can be attributed to pores which enhanced ability in UV-light harvesting. What's more, the existence of rutile/anatase phase junction is favorable for the formation and separation of the hole-electron pair, resulting in a reduced electron-hole recombination.
